Job Duties

  • Manage the breakfast operation including appropriate breakfast and lunch prep for expected volume and banquet activity
  • Communicate with AM Breakfast Attendants to ensure they are informed on daily requirements and timing
  • Supervise the weekly specialty breakfast item program for guest satisfaction
  • Supervise the execution of banquet lunches ensuring production guidelines and schedules are met
  • Ensure daily and weekly cleaning schedules are followed and assign cleaning tasks
  • Ensure Ecosure health and sanitation standards are adhered to including temperature logs and proper food labeling
  • Supervise and enhance the daily employee lunch program including menu preparation and focus on healthy cost-effective items
